Ошибки «Attempted execute of noexecute memory» и их решение

Attempted execute of noexecute memory ошибка является ошибкой, которая возникает в операционной системе Windows при попытке выполнить код в области памяти, которая помечена как неисполняемая. Ошибка указывает на то, что программное обеспечение или драйвер не может выполнить код из определенной области памяти.

В следующих разделах статьи мы рассмотрим, что такое память с запретом выполнения, как работает механизм защиты от выполнения и почему возникает ошибка Attempted execute of noexecute memory. Мы также рассмотрим возможные причины и способы устранения этой ошибки, чтобы помочь вам решить проблему и добиться стабильной работы вашей операционной системы Windows.

Ошибка «Attempted execute of noexecute memory» и как ее исправить

Ошибка «Attempted execute of noexecute memory» является сообщением об ошибке, которое может возникать при работе операционной системы Windows. Эта ошибка указывает на то, что процесс пытается выполнить код из области памяти, которая помечена как «noexecute».

В операционной системе Windows используется технология Data Execution Prevention (DEP), которая предотвращает выполнение кода из определенных областей памяти. Это сделано для защиты от вредоносных программ, которые могут использовать уязвимости в программном обеспечении для выполнения вредоносного кода. Когда процесс пытается выполнить код из области памяти, помеченной как «noexecute», возникает ошибка «Attempted execute of noexecute memory».

Возможные причины ошибки «Attempted execute of noexecute memory»:

  • Проблемы с драйверами устройств. Устаревшие или неправильно установленные драйверы могут вызывать ошибку.
  • Конфликты между программным обеспечением. Некоторые программы могут быть несовместимыми и вызывать ошибку при попытке выполнить код из «noexecute» области памяти.
  • Поврежденные файлы системы. Некорректно работающие или поврежденные файлы операционной системы могут вызывать ошибку.

Как исправить ошибку «Attempted execute of noexecute memory»:

  1. Обновите драйверы устройств. Проверьте, что у вас установлены последние версии драйверов для всех устройств. Вы можете загрузить последние версии драйверов с веб-сайтов производителей устройств или использовать программное обеспечение для обновления драйверов.
  2. Отключите или удалите некомпатибельные программы. Если вы заметили, что ошибка начала появляться после установки определенной программы, попробуйте отключить или удалить эту программу и проверьте, исчезнет ли ошибка.
  3. Проверьте целостность файлов системы. В операционной системе Windows есть инструмент «Проверка целостности системных файлов», который может помочь восстановить поврежденные или неправильно работающие файлы. Выполните команду «sfc /scannow» в командной строке от имени администратора, чтобы запустить этот инструмент.
  4. Проверьте наличие вредоносных программ. Запустите антивирусное программное обеспечение и выполните полное сканирование системы, чтобы убедиться, что ваш компьютер не заражен вредоносными программами. Если обнаружены вредоносные программы, удалите их.

Если ни одно из вышеперечисленных решений не помогло исправить ошибку «Attempted execute of noexecute memory», рекомендуется обратиться к профессиональному специалисту или службе поддержки операционной системы Windows для получения дополнительной помощи.

Fix Attempted Execute of Noexecute Memory blue error in Windows 11/10 (9/8/2023 Updated)

Понятие ошибки «Attempted execute of noexecute memory»

Ошибка «Attempted execute of noexecute memory» (попытка выполнить неисполняемую память) – это ошибка, которая может возникнуть в операционных системах Windows, связанная с попыткой выполнить код или инструкции, которые помечены как неисполняемые.

В современных операционных системах используется механизм Data Execution Prevention (DEP), который предназначен для защиты системы от вредоносного кода и атак, связанных с выполнением кода из областей памяти, которые предназначены только для хранения данных. DEP помечает память как исполняемую (executable) или неисполняемую (non-executable) и не позволяет выполнять инструкции из неисполняемой памяти.

Ошибка «Attempted execute of noexecute memory» возникает, когда приложение или процесс пытается выполнить инструкции из памяти, которая помечена как неисполняемая. Это может быть вызвано ошибкой программирования, попыткой изменения защищенных областей памяти или внедрением вредоносного кода.

Причины возникновения ошибки «Attempted execute of noexecute memory»

Существует несколько возможных причин возникновения ошибки «Attempted execute of noexecute memory»:

  • Нарушение прав доступа – приложение или процесс пытается выполнить инструкции из области памяти, для которой у него нет прав доступа;
  • Попытка изменения защищенных областей памяти – приложение или процесс пытается изменить содержимое памяти, которая является неисполняемой;
  • Внедрение вредоносного кода – злоумышленники могут попытаться злоупотребить функцией выполнения кода из неисполняемой памяти для выполнения своего вредоносного кода.

Как исправить ошибку «Attempted execute of noexecute memory»

Для исправления ошибки «Attempted execute of noexecute memory» рекомендуется выполнить следующие действия:

  1. Перезапустить компьютер – иногда перезапуск может помочь временно устранить ошибку;
  2. Проверить наличие обновлений операционной системы и установить их – обновления могут содержать исправления для известных проблем, включая ошибку «Attempted execute of noexecute memory»;
  3. Проверить наличие обновлений для установленных программ – обновления программ могут содержать исправления для известных проблем, которые могут вызывать ошибку;
  4. Проверить компьютер на наличие вирусов и вредоносного ПО – некоторые вредоносные программы могут пытаться изменить области памяти, что может вызывать ошибку «Attempted execute of noexecute memory». Используйте антивирусное программное обеспечение для сканирования компьютера и удаления обнаруженных угроз;
  5. Проверить жесткий диск на наличие ошибок – ошибки на жестком диске могут быть причиной проблем с памятью. Выполните проверку жесткого диска с помощью встроенных средств операционной системы или сторонних программ;
  6. Обратиться за помощью к специалисту – если все вышеперечисленные действия не помогли устранить ошибку, рекомендуется обратиться к специалисту по информационной безопасности или технической поддержке операционной системы для дальнейшего решения проблемы.

Важно отметить, что ошибка «Attempted execute of noexecute memory» может быть вызвана различными факторами, поэтому реальная причина и способ ее исправления могут зависеть от конкретной ситуации. Рекомендуется следовать указанным выше рекомендациям и обратиться за помощью, если проблема продолжается или возникает регулярно.

Симптомы ошибки «Attempted execute of noexecute memory»

Ошибка «Attempted execute of noexecute memory» обычно возникает в операционной системе Windows и может указывать на проблемы с памятью или несоответствиями в настройках операционной системы. Когда возникает эта ошибка, компьютер может зависнуть или перезагрузиться, что может создать неудобства для пользователя. Чтобы лучше понять и решить эту проблему, необходимо знать некоторые симптомы этой ошибки.

1. Синий экран смерти (BSOD)

Часто ошибка «Attempted execute of noexecute memory» приводит к появлению синего экрана смерти (BSOD). Это является серьезным симптомом ошибки, и компьютер автоматически перезагружается для защиты от возможного повреждения системы. Синий экран смерти содержит информацию об ошибке, включая код ошибки, который может быть полезен при поиске решения проблемы.

2. Ошибка при выполнении программы

Если возникает ошибка «Attempted execute of noexecute memory», программа, которая запущена на компьютере, может прекратить свою работу или выдать сообщение об ошибке. Это может быть связано с тем, что программа пытается выполнить операцию с запрещенной памятью. В таком случае, пользователь может столкнуться с проблемой, потерей данных или неожиданной остановкой работы программы.

3. Зависание или замедление работы компьютера

Ошибка «Attempted execute of noexecute memory» также может привести к зависанию или замедлению работы компьютера. Компьютер может отвечать медленно на команды пользователя или периодически «зависать», что делает его непригодным для нормального использования. Это может быть особенно раздражающим, когда пользователь занят важной работой или игрой.

Итак, симптомы ошибки «Attempted execute of noexecute memory» включают синий экран смерти, ошибку выполнения программы и зависание или замедление работы компьютера. Если вы столкнулись с этой ошибкой, рекомендуется обратиться к специалисту или провести дополнительные исследования, чтобы определить причину и найти решение проблемы.

Возможные способы исправления ошибки «Attempted execute of noexecute memory»

Ошибка «Attempted execute of noexecute memory» может возникнуть при работе с операционной системой Windows и связана с проблемами памяти. В этом тексте мы рассмотрим несколько возможных способов исправления данной ошибки.

1. Перезагрузка компьютера

Прежде чем предпринимать другие действия, стоит сделать перезагрузку компьютера. Это простое и эффективное решение, которое может помочь во многих случаях. При перезагрузке компьютера операционная система будет загружена заново, что может помочь восстановить нормальную работу и устранить ошибку.

2. Обновление операционной системы и драйверов

Ошибка «Attempted execute of noexecute memory» может быть вызвана несовместимостью программного обеспечения с системой или устаревшими драйверами. Чтобы исправить эту проблему, стоит обновить операционную систему и драйверы до последних версий. Для этого нужно открыть меню «Пуск», выбрать «Параметры», затем «Обновление и безопасность» и нажать на кнопку «Проверить наличие обновлений». Если доступны обновления, следуйте инструкциям на экране для их установки.

3. Проверка наличия вредоносных программ

Наличие вредоносных программ на компьютере может вызвать ошибку «Attempted execute of noexecute memory». Для исправления этой проблемы стоит провести проверку системы на наличие вирусов, троянов и других вредоносных программ. Для этого можно использовать антивирусное программное обеспечение, такое как Windows Defender или сторонние программы. Запустите полную проверку системы и удалите обнаруженные угрозы.

4. Отключение защиты памяти

В некоторых случаях, отключение функции защиты памяти может помочь исправить ошибку «Attempted execute of noexecute memory». Для этого нужно открыть меню «Пуск», выбрать «Параметры», затем «Система», «О системе», «Дополнительные параметры системы». В открывшемся окне выберите вкладку «Дополнительно» и нажмите на кнопку «Настройка» в разделе «Производительность». В новом окне выберите вкладку «Предотвращение выполнения данных» и установите опцию «Включить DEP для всех программ и служб, за исключением тех к которым я доверяю» или «Включить DEP только для важных программ и служб Windows». Нажмите «ОК», чтобы сохранить изменения.

Это не исчерпывающий список всех возможных способов исправления ошибки «Attempted execute of noexecute memory», но представленные рекомендации могут помочь вам решить проблему. Если проблема не устраняется после применения этих методов, рекомендуется обратиться к специалисту для получения профессиональной помощи.

Дополнительные рекомендации и предостережения

При возникновении ошибки «Attempted execute of noexecute memory» существуют несколько дополнительных рекомендаций и предостережений, которые могут помочь в решении данной проблемы.

1. Установка обновлений и исправлений

Во многих случаях ошибка «Attempted execute of noexecute memory» может быть вызвана проблемами с программным обеспечением или драйверами устройств. Поэтому рекомендуется регулярно проверять наличие обновлений и исправлений для операционной системы и установленных программ.

2. Проверка совместимости программ и драйверов

Если ошибка возникает после установки нового программного обеспечения или драйвера, возможно, они несовместимы с вашей операционной системой. В таком случае рекомендуется проверить совместимость программ и драйверов с вашей системой, а также попробовать установить более старые версии или искать альтернативные программы и драйверы.

3. Проверка наличия вредоносного ПО

Ошибки «Attempted execute of noexecute memory» могут быть также вызваны вредоносным программным обеспечением, которое находится на вашем компьютере. Рекомендуется регулярно проводить проверку наличия вредоносного ПО с помощью антивирусной программы и антишпионского ПО.

4. Проверка работы аппаратного обеспечения

Ошибка «Attempted execute of noexecute memory» может быть вызвана проблемами с аппаратным обеспечением, например, повреждением оперативной памяти. В таком случае рекомендуется провести проверку работы аппаратного обеспечения, например, с помощью специальных диагностических утилит.

5. Обратитесь за помощью

Если все вышеперечисленные рекомендации не помогли решить проблему, рекомендуется обратиться за помощью к специалисту или веб-форумам, где другие пользователи могут предложить свои идеи и решения.

Как избежать ошибки «Attempted execute of noexecute memory»

Ошибка «Attempted execute of noexecute memory» (попытка выполнить память, не предназначенную для выполнения) возникает при попытке выполнить код в памяти, которая была помечена как «неисполняемая». Эта ошибка может возникнуть при запуске программы или при выполнении определенного действия в операционной системе.

Чтобы избежать ошибки «Attempted execute of noexecute memory», рекомендуется следовать следующим рекомендациям:

1. Проверьте целостность системных файлов

Ошибки «Attempted execute of noexecute memory» могут быть вызваны повреждением системных файлов. Для исправления этой проблемы, выполните проверку целостности системных файлов с помощью инструмента System File Checker (SFC). Для этого откройте командную строку от имени администратора и выполните команду «sfc /scannow». Это поможет восстановить поврежденные файлы и устранить ошибку.

2. Обновите драйверы

Устаревшие или неправильно установленные драйверы могут быть причиной ошибки «Attempted execute of noexecute memory». Рекомендуется обновить все драйверы на компьютере до последних версий. Драйверы обычно можно загрузить с официального веб-сайта производителя вашего оборудования или использовать специализированные инструменты для обновления драйверов.

3. Проверьте наличие вредоносного программного обеспечения

Некоторые вредоносные программы могут привести к ошибке «Attempted execute of noexecute memory». Рекомендуется выполнить полное сканирование системы с помощью антивирусного программного обеспечения, чтобы обнаружить и удалить все вредоносные программы.

4. Проверьте оперативную память

Ошибка «Attempted execute of noexecute memory» также может быть вызвана поврежденным или неисправным модулем оперативной памяти. Рекомендуется выполнить проверку оперативной памяти с помощью специализированных инструментов, таких как Memtest86. Если обнаружены ошибки, замените поврежденный модуль оперативной памяти.

5. Обновите операционную систему

Устаревшая версия операционной системы может быть причиной ошибки «Attempted execute of noexecute memory». Рекомендуется обновить операционную систему до последней версии, чтобы устранить возможные ошибки и проблемы совместимости.

Следуя этим рекомендациям, вы сможете избежать ошибки «Attempted execute of noexecute memory» и обеспечить стабильную работу вашей системы.

Рейтинг
( Пока оценок нет )
Загрузка ...